Word origin

A compound of 研 (yán, 'to grind, study closely') and 究 (jiū, 'to investigate thoroughly'). 研 is a phono-semantic compound of 石 (shí, 'stone') with a phonetic element, originally 'to grind'; 究 combines 穴 (xué, 'cave') with 九 (jiǔ) as phonetic.

研究 (yán jiū) means research, study, investigate. It is used as a verb in everyday Mandarin speech.
